I dreamt of an angel kneeling,
there was sadness in her face.
She was in a wondrous meadow
and her tears seemed out of place.
I wondered, as she knelt there,
why she’d venture far from home
to this particular time and place.
What led her to roam?
She bowed her head in prayer
in an angelic fashion.
Seeing her in such a pose
my heart filled with compassion.
I listened to her prayer
of resurrection and rebirth.
It was a prayer of hope
for the future of the earth.
I went to kneel beside her
to add my prayer and plea
when suddenly she looked up
and that’s when she said to me:
“I am only an angel,
I can do no more than pray
but you can change the world
with your choices everyday.
My prayers were not for God
to save this wondrous place.
They were for you to stand up
and take your rightful place.”
Suddenly it was clear to me,
she was praying for our sake.
We didn’t need a miracle,
the future was ours to make.
